M31 canteen marked M. & C. 40
Stunning combat used M31 pattern canteen. The canteen is marked M. & C. 40 which indicates and manufacturer which is still unknown till this day! Almost all M. & C. produced canteens are made in 1939 and are in completely unissued condition, sometimes even together with the original factory box. Finding a 1940 dated example made by M. & C. in combat used condition is rare!

Stunning(!) sketchbook or Skitzenbuch by Hans Liska
This sketchbook, first brought out in 1942, features many drawings and watercolours of the German artist Hans Liska. Liska was a artist born in 1907 and drafted into a Propagandakompanie in 1939. He illustrated his war and bundled his sketchbook in his Skitzenbuch. The book is a great pictorial reference to the war with many stunning and fascinating illustrations. Rare late war M42 messkit made by helmet maker ET
A very rare late war messkit marked ET43 This maker was a well known helmet manufacturer in the war. The ET marking is often seen marked in helmets and it belongs to the factory of Eisenhüttenwerke, Thale.
A rare messkit made by a well known helmet manufacturor!
